| Help: Quitting smoking is harder than I thought
I was suppose to have quit smoking last week and did good for a day, then I went right back to it. I'm only smoking 2 per day but I am laying them down tomorrow and not looking back. I'm afraid that when I go for my pre-op on 7/31, that the nicotine will still be in my system and I won't be able to have surgery, or they will postpone it. Surgery date is 8/13. Do you know if anyone has had their surg. date changed or canceled because the didn't quit smoking when soon enough before surgery? Surely it will be out of my system by 7/31.

OK look. Here's the deal. The longer you put it off the harder it's going to be. Get rid of them tonight.
I dont have info about dates being postponed or what have you, but depending on youe surgeon's demeanor he might straight out refuse to operate on you as opposed to postponing you. They dont like it when you dont follow instruction. It's a leading indicator that you might be a problem post op not following eating instructions/ schedules etc.
I dont mean to be hard on you but you know i've been there. I smoked up to two packs a day for 15 years. The only way to do it s to not put it off, and to live with the withdrawl for a bit. If i can do it, you can too. If this surgery is what you want, and in additional a healthy lifestyle GET RID OF THEM RIGHT NOW!!!!!! You can do it.

The new prescription drug is called Chantix and it works fantastically. I smoked for 37 years and was able to just put them aside and forget them taking the Chantix. Your're supposed to take the pills for a week before you quit so you would already be behind the curve, and that's assuming you can get the prescription right away.
Side effects include vivid dreams (not quite nightmares, but ...) and some stomach upset.
Patches might help, but I think the idea is to get the nicotine out of your system and patches work by giving you nicotine transdermally - so it's still in you system. If you are only smoking two cigarettes a day (not two packs right?) then you should probably forget about the patches an just throw them away. You're that close to quitting! Just take that last step.
